We have the privilege of presenting to the market this impressive, detached family home (2334 sq ft) with 4/5 bedrooms and three reception rooms, occupying a wonderful private plot extending to circa 0.28 of an acre in a desirable suburban location easily accessible to numerous facilities.

A large 4/5 bedroom detached family home occupying a wonderful private plot extending to circa 0.28 of an acre in a desirable High Oakham location within walking distance to High Oakham Primary School and excellent local amenities.

The property is presented in immaculate condition throughout and boasts 2334 sq ft of spacious and versatile family living accommodation arranged over two floors with 4/5 bedrooms and three reception rooms. The ground floor layout of accommodation comprises an impressive entrance hall with full height ceiling exposure up to the galleried landing. There is a cloakroom/WC, sitting room/bedroom five, 24ft lounge, separate dining room, kitchen open plan to breakfast/dining area extension with three large roof windows and sliding bi-fold doors which allows an abundance of natural daylight into the room. There is a useful built-in boot/storage cupboard, utility room and cloakroom/WC. The first floor galleried landing leads to a large master bedroom with extensive fitted wardrobes and a contemporary en suite. There are three further good sized double bedrooms and a family bathroom with bath and separate shower. The property has an alarm system, UPVC double glazing and gas central heating with Nest app.

Overall, this is a fantastic opportunity ideal for growing families and internal viewing is highly recommended.

Outside - The property is well screened and set back from High Oakham Road and stands in the middle of a large plot extending to circa 0.28 of an acre with beautifully well maintained mature gardens offering excellent privacy. The property is approached through a gated entrance onto a block paved driveway flanked by low retaining walled boundaries providing ample off road parking leading to an integral double garage with a remote controlled electric door. The front garden is mainly laid to lawn with extensive borders to all sides featuring a variety of mature plants, shrubs, and trees. There are paths to each side of the house providing access to the rear and to an adjoining heated storeroom with a radiator. There is a stunning and private rear garden featuring a slate and stone patio extending across the full width of the house with a barbecue area. There is a well maintained central lawn with established shrubs and trees to all sides offering a lovely private garden which benefits from a westerly aspect. There is a summerhouse with decked patio immediately in front, a small shed, and a workshop/shed equipped with power and light.

    Broadband availability and predicted speed: obtained from Ofcom on September 29, 2022

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on September 29, 2022

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
